The purpose of the article is an attempt to summarize the historical experience of implementing a regional policy to strengthen one of the key Chinese regions - Central China based on the study of Chinese-language documents and monographs of Chinese scientists. Consistent course of the Chinese government at the beginning of the 21st century was focused on the coordinated development of four key Chinese macro-regions. Separate strategies were developed for strengthening Western China, reviving the industrial Northeast of the PRC, and maintaining the pace of economic growth in the Eastern Coastal Region. A special role was assigned to the implementation of the strategy of the rise of the Central Region, concerning the creation of a key grain region of the country, a manufacturing center, a transport and logistics hub in the six central provinces of Henan, Hubei, Hunan, Anhui, Jiangxi and Shanxi. This strategy fit into the main vector of the five-year planning of the Chinese state and was supplemented by a whole range of spatial transformation projects corresponding to the specifics of the territory of the Central Region of the PRC. The Central Region has made significant progress in using the advantages of its location to achieve economic results. The development of strategic new industries, such as the innovative production of new types of materials has accelerated, the competitiveness of the industrial system of the Central Region has increased, and the amount of foreign investment in projects for the spatial transformation of Central China as well. The central provinces are included in the priority interregional projects.
